Hey all,

I'm trying to get the door glass out of my 69 Camaro. I have no idea what I need to do to get the glass out. I have already unbolted the glass from the regulator, but I have no further ideas from here. :banghead:

Some help would be much appreciated.

There's a few steps, but here's the bullet points:
-Rmove the up stops from the rear guide and front lower sash channel
-Loosen the stabilizers at the top of the door frame
-Loosen the upper retaining bolts on the front & rear window guides
-Remove the lower sash-channel cam attaching nuts (PS - the studs are attached at the bottom of the window so be careful pushing these out of the channel. hold the bottom of the glass when you do this).

Lift the window thru the top of the door - you may have to slide it a little forward and tilt the glass in toward the car to get the rollers to clear the sill.
